摘要
从电力金具的选型、设计、生产、运输、安装和优化改造等环节提出了降低超高压输电线路电晕噪声的对策措施。同时,通过对超高压输电线路铁塔可听噪声和金具电晕放电情况的检测,验证优化改造金具的降噪效果,查找金具安装的缺陷和漏洞,为金具制造和设计、预防电晕措施的选择及电力金具的改良、安装和运行等方面提供决策和参考依据。
